Comprehending Mobility Scooters
Mobility scooters are electric lorries designed for those with restricted mobility. They range in size, design, and cost. Usually, mobility scooters can be classified into three categories:
| Type | Description | Suitable For |
|---|---|---|
| Class 2 | Smaller sized, lightweight models for usage on pathways and in stores | Indoor usage and brief outside journeys |
| Class 3 | Larger, more effective scooters for road use | Active outside users needing more range |
| Durable | High-capacity scooters developed for larger people | Users requiring additional support and stability |
Secret Features to Consider
When choosing the right mobility scooter, it's vital to consider numerous elements that will impact your total experience. Here are crucial features to examine:
| Feature | Value |
|---|---|
| Weight Capacity | Ensure it can support your weight conveniently. |
| Range | Think about how far you need to take a trip on a single charge. |
| Speed | Try to find scooters with differing speed settings if necessary. |
| Turning Radius | A smaller sized radius is perfect for indoor use. |
| Mobility | Foldable designs are excellent for transportation and storage. |
| Battery Life | Longer battery life indicates less regular charging. |
| Comfort | Look for adjustable seats and general ergonomics. |

Rates Guide
The price of mobility scooters can differ significantly based upon features, brand name, and condition. Here's a basic prices guide:
| Type | Rate Range |
|---|---|
| Class 2 | ₤ 800 - ₤ 1,500 |
| Class 3 | ₤ 1,500 - ₤ 3,000 |
| Heavy-Duty | ₤ 2,000 - ₤ 4,000 |
| Used Models | ₤ 300 - ₤ 1,500 (depending upon condition) |
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. Are mobility scooters covered by insurance?
Numerous insurance coverage strategies, including Medicare, might cover part of the expense for mobility scooters if they are considered medically required. It is vital to contact your service provider for specific eligibility requirements and paperwork required.
2. The length of time do mobility scooters last?
With appropriate care and upkeep, mobility scooters normally last between 3 to 5 years. Regular battery maintenance, cleansing, and following the maker's standards can prolong the life expectancy.
3. Can I take my scooter on public transportation?
A lot of public transportation systems allow mobility scooters, but policies differ by place. It's a good idea to talk to your regional transport authority for specific rules concerning dimensions and usage.
4. How do I preserve my mobility scooter?
Routine upkeep includes examining tire pressure, cleaning the scooter, charging the battery correctly, and examining moving parts for wear and tear. Follow the producer's upkeep schedule for finest outcomes.
5. What is the weight limitation for mobility scooters?
Weight limitations vary by model, typically varying from 250 to 500 pounds. Constantly select a scooter that can securely accommodate your weight to make sure optimal performance and safety.
